logo

Output 2266afe52ff3a51d8615ae1578ebab58778ae316694f42010aa13f84c9295247: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d886747aeb1005fa9bc62ae735b42a20c3627c61 OP_EQUAL
address
3MRtx5P55YrdSrofv56KA6ooM6JMpQrKXx
transaction
2266afe52ff3a51d8615ae1578ebab58778ae316694f42010aa13f84c9295247